Electronic Flora of South Australia species Fact Sheet

Family: Cactaceae
Opuntia elatior

Citation: Miller, Gard. Dict. edn 8 (1768).

Synonymy: Not Applicable

Common name: None

Description:
Tall shrub to 5 m high; joints elliptic to round, olive-green, 10-40 cm long; spines 2-8, acicular, terete, 2-7 cm, long, dark-brown.

Flowers c. 5 cm across, deep-yellow striped red or pink.

Fruit subovoid, red, dark-red inside.

Distribution:  S.Aust.: LE, NU, GT, FR, EA, EP, MU, YP, SL.   N.T.; Qld; N.S.W.   Native to Panama, Colombia, Curacao and Venezuela.

Conservation status: naturalised
